Constance has been taking classes at a college for the last seven years. She is not pursuing any degree, just going through the

motions of being a student. Constance is a(n) __________.
Social Studies
1 answer:
Ira Lisetskai [31]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

Ritualist

Explanation:

In sociology, the term ritualist refers to the to the practice of going through the motions of daily life even when the person doesn't accept the goals or values that come with those practices. In other words, the person rejects the institutionalized goals but still takes part in its institutional ways.

Constance has been taking classes at college for 7 years. She is not pursuing any degree but going through the motions of being a student. We can say that <u>she is just going through the motions of being a student but without really accepting the goals of being a student (which would be to pursue a degree and graduate from college)</u>. Therefore, this would be an example of a ritualist.
